When a crack is past repair

Some damage can't be filled with resin. Here's when replacement is the safe call.

  • Cracks longer than a dollar bill, or ones that keep growing
  • Damage right in the driver's line of sight
  • Chips that reach the edge of the glass or go through both layers
  • Several breaks close together
What's included

The replacement, start to finish

A windshield does real structural work in a crash, so the install has to be done right, not just quickly. Here's what a job with us covers.

  • Glass matched to your VIN, including rain-sensor and camera brackets
  • Old glass and adhesive cut out cleanly, pinch-weld prepped and primed
  • Fresh automotive urethane and a proper set, not a rushed press-in
  • New moldings and clips where the old ones don't come off intact
  • ADAS camera recalibration on vehicles that need it
  • A clear safe drive-away time before we leave

Windshield replacement FAQ

How long before I can drive after a windshield replacement?

The adhesive needs to cure to a safe strength before you drive. With modern fast-cure urethane that's often about an hour, though cold or damp weather can make it longer. We tell you the exact safe drive-away time for the product and conditions on the day.

Do you use OEM glass?

We fit glass that meets the original safety and optical standards for your vehicle, and we can source OEM glass when you want it or when the vehicle's camera system calls for it. We'll tell you what we're installing before we start.

Will a replacement affect my lane-keep or auto-braking?

If your car has a forward-facing camera on the windshield, it has to be recalibrated after the glass is replaced so those systems read the road correctly. We handle that recalibration as part of the job on vehicles that need it.
